A Bag for Life by Jacqui Jones
"In this work I’ve sculpted alternative plastic bags from ‘Harmless Dissolve’ The bags are formed in the shape of embryonic figures and filled with a seeds saplings etc. Each ‘bag’ has burst as water has been poured on to it allowing some of the contents to spill out. The piece reflects on the vulnerability of the human race and an awareness that green plastics may offer opportunities for regrowth."
